? Where does this number come from?
DNSniffer ingests Certificate Transparency logs continuously and records the issuer of the most recent certificate seen for each domain, then snapshots the per-issuer count once a day. It measures how much of the live web a CA currently secures, not how many certificates it has issued over its lifetime.
